Transaction 75343076f9a645145cb0dbd9c56b1e88900f22c724cb87956a30f79ece0ffcce
1 Input
1 Output
-
75343076f9a645145cb0dbd9c56b1e88900f22c724cb87956a30f79ece0ffcce:0
- value
- 383820
- script pubkey
- OP_0 OP_PUSHBYTES_20 badcf4f56c37418257a5a86a58d321b1cdc335fa
- address
- bc1qhtw0fatvxaqcy4a94p4935epk8xuxd06c7udpz